Otoplasty (ear pinning surgery) at MUDr. Šimek's Olomouc practice corrects prominent, protruding ears through cartilage reshaping and repositioning under local infiltration anaesthesia, with all incisions made on the back of the ear where resulting scars remain hidden. The correction is available for both children and adults — MUDr. Šimek's documentation emphasises the value of early correction in children to prevent social stigma before school age, while noting that adult otoplasty is equally effective and can be performed at any age. Bandages are worn for a minimum of 12 days, followed by a soft headband worn nightly for approximately one month.
Prominent ear deformity — otapostasis — is primarily a failure of the antihelix fold to develop normally during cartilage formation before birth, which allows the ear to project forward rather than lying flat against the skull. It is present from birth and does not resolve spontaneously. Correction by surgical otoplasty is effective, stable, and the incisions are placed in a position that renders scars clinically invisible. **MUDr. Šimek's technique** Access is through an incision on the posterior surface of the auricle (the back of the ear), which is hidden when the ears are viewed from the front, profile, or three-quarter angle. Through this incision, the anterior cartilage surface is approached directly. Concentric incisions in the cartilage create controlled weakening along the plane where the antihelix should fold — this allows the cartilage to be re-shaped into a normal profile. The new position is fixed through the scarring process rather than through sutures that hold tension permanently (a more stable long-term result). Modelling sutures are removed when the bandages come off (approximately day 12); the access incision sutures are removed two days later. **Children vs adult patients** The procedure is suitable for children from the age when the ear cartilage has reached approximately 85% of adult size — typically from 5–6 years. Correction at this age prevents the documented social and psychological impact of prominent ears during the school years. In the Czech Republic, the procedure may be eligible for health insurance coverage for children up to a certain age when medical indication is documented. Adult otoplasty is fully self-pay and equally effective — cartilage is somewhat stiffer in adults, which actually improves surgical predictability in some cases. **Anaesthesia** Local infiltration anaesthesia is used in the vast majority of cases, including for children in whom the clinic's assessment finds adequate cooperation. General anaesthesia is reserved for very young or anxious children who cannot remain still. This is an important practical consideration for families planning the procedure for school-age children. **Post-operative management** Bandages applied immediately post-procedure are worn for a minimum of 12 days — this duration reflects the time required for the cartilage to stabilise in its corrected position through the initial fibrotic healing phase. After bandage removal, a soft elastic headband is worn nightly for approximately one month to protect the ears during sleep (particularly to prevent acute angulation against a pillow). In cold weather, a hat or ear covering is recommended for several weeks. Complications — haematoma, infection, wound dehiscence — are uncommon with standard antibiotic cover and proper bandage care. **Realistic expectations** Otoplasty changes the relationship between the ear and the skull, creating a natural-looking lie against the head. The goal is symmetry and anatomical positioning rather than a specific aesthetic standard — MUDr. Šimek discusses target positioning with each patient at consultation using before-and-after reference images.
